élastique specifications
platforms
The SDK is available for the following platforms
- x86 (Windows 9x/ME/NT4.0/2000/XP32/Vista32/Win7, MacOSX, Linux)
- x64 (Windows XP64/Vista64/Win7x64, Linux64, MacOSX)
- PPC 32/64 (MacOSX: UB)
performance
élastique Pro
The system workload on a 1GHz computer for time-stretching a stereo-signal at 44.1kHz in default mode is between ca. 9% and 25% depending on the stretch factor.
élastique efficient
The system workload on a 1GHz computer for time-stretching a stereo-signal at 44.1kHz is between ca. 4% and 10% depending on the stretch factor.
élastique SOLOIST V2.0
The system workload on a 1GHz computer for the analysis of a stereo-signal at 44.1kHz is about 8%, for the synthesis of this stereo-signal about 1.5%.
input specs
The supported number of channels is 48.
The supported sample rates are between 32kHz and 384kHz.
